Stuttering Arsenal continue to underperform with another lacklustre performance against Schalke. by Adam Kemp
The rollercoaster ride that is Arsenal has begun to loop round once again this season. From the sublime to the ridiculous; who am I kidding – from the average to the ridiculous? What is compelling about our underperformance this season is the fact that we have failed to score in 33% of our games this season. We have played twelve games and fired blanks on four occasions which demonstrates that this team has lost its ability to penetrate in the final third. The Carrow Road syndrome was repeated tonight against better opposition and we were severely outclassed. To manage one measly shot on target against an average European side at home is without doubt a disgrace.
